Patma

Patma is a village located in Khadganva tehsil of Koriya district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 29km away from sub-district headquarter Khadganva (tehsildar office) and 41km away from district headquarter Baikunthpur. As per 2009 stats, Patma village is also a gram panchayat.

About Patma

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Patma is 431796. The village spans a total geographical area of 960.96 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 497449. Chirmiri is nearest town to Patma village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 29km away.

Population of Patma

Below is a concise population overview of Patma as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,430 694 736
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 241 118 123
Scheduled Castes (SC) 147 81 66
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 1,125 546 579
Literate Population 636 361 275
Illiterate Population 794 333 461

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Patma village:

  • The total population of Patma village is around 1,430, including approximately 694 males and 736 females, with a sex ratio of 1060 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 241 children aged 0–6 years in Patma village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Patma village has 147 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 1,125 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Patma village is about 44.48%, with male literacy at 52.02% and female literacy at 37.36%.
  • There are around 332 households in Patma village.

Connectivity of Patma

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Patma. As per the 2011 stats, Patma had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
